I was born on january 1, 1863, in Paris, France. As an educator, I helped create the first modern Olympic Games. They were held
ruslelena [56]
<span>Pierre de Coubertin was born 1st January, 1863, in Paris. He was a founding member of the International Olympic Committee. As a result of his classical and strong education, he idolised the Olympic Games of the Ancient Greeks, and revitalised them for audiences today.</span>

Although originally there was no specific code of conduct for Knights, later on however, -somewhere toward the end of the Middle Ages- the Code of Chivalry was established to govern the conduct and behavior of Knights

This code formulated guidelines for all knights to follow such as:

all knights should be honorable, merciful, honest and loyal. It also bound knights to protect those in need, particularly the poor and anyone unable to protect themselves, particularly women and children.
